➡️Obtain Suitable Soil:
- Flowers thrive in good soil. Whether you’re planting in a pot or a garden, quality soil is essential.
- If you don’t already have good soil, find out the best potting mix for the specific flowers you’re growing.
➡️Select the Right Location:
- Consider sunlight and shade.
- Some flowers prefer full sun, while others thrive in partial shade.
- Choose a spot that suits the light requirements of your flowers.
➡️Choose Your Flowers:
- Visit a local gardening center to select flowers that you enjoy.
- Look for tags or seed packets to check the flower’s growth size, whether it’s an annual or perennial, and its watering needs.
➡️Plant Your Flowers:
- Dig individual holes for each plant.
- Place each plant into the hole at the same soil level as it was in the pot.
- Fill in the empty space around each flower with soil, covering the top of the root ball.
- Avoid covering the stem with dirt.
➡️Water and Care:
- Water your flowers consistently, keeping the soil moist.
- Mulch the garden bed with organic matter to conserve moisture and suppress weeds.
